I began the Safe Harbor - Eckhart Tolle Study Group in early 2004. After reading the Power of Now when it was first published in the autumn of 1999, I realized that this was a truly special expression of the teaching. And what is the teaching? Simply put, Eckhart is inviting us to:
Move beyond the emotions and the counter-productive antics of the ego aka the unobserved mind;
Connect with a deep inner stillness that exists within each of us as our true state of Being;
Rediscover a lasting peace, love and compassion that naturally flows outward into the world around us;
Be enJOY... so that the touch of Grace might dance through us!

Meditation ~
Close your eyes. Exhale. Then inhale deeply.
Visualize the life energy of your breath, filling every cell of your body.
When a thought stream begins, watch it arise and fall like a wave in the sea.
See that there is no need to resist the thought or to create a belief or a conflict out of it.
Gently remind yourself: "I can have peace instead of this thought, belief or conflict."
Simply see the thought float away into the vastness of the ocean to become as though it never was.
Now ask yourself: "Who am I without this thought?"
Abide as That... I AM...

Practicing Forgiveness ~
Often when you first begin to awaken, you become aware of past, unconscious behavior that you perceive has caused harm to another or to self. This realization can trigger feelings of guilt or shame. Keep in mind that this mind-set is once again the ego, pulling you back into a never-ending cycle of more unconscious behavior. However if you can bring forgiveness into the present moment, a space will arise in which the mistakes of the past can be healed once and for all.
To practice forgiveness in the present moment, visualize a stream of pure white light radiating from your heart center. Now, see that white light extend outward until it surrounds each person involved.
Also remember that true forgiveness is a gift of Love, given freely and without expectation. When forgiveness is offered unconditionally, there is no separation between the giver and the receiver... and the offering itself becomes unlimited in its potential... Like a stone tossed into the stream of Life, it ripples on forever...  into the Infinite Eternal. I see forgiveness, as well as Love, as the breath of Consciousness.
Last but not least if you can be in complete acceptance and without judgment, you have also moved beyond the need for forgiveness... at that point, healing has already taken place.

A Glossary of Key Terms in Practicing Presence

As Eckhart so often reminds us, all words are merely pointers.

Unmanifested: the spaciousness or stillness from which everything arises and falls; God; the Infinite/Eternal; Life.

Manifested: all of form, including our thoughts, beliefs, emotions and personality as well as physical objects.

Ego: the identification with form. Ego gains strength through desire, attachment and the need to be special.

All expressions of the ego, including anger, jealousy, indifference, judgment, resentment and suspicion, are rooted in the universal fear of loosing the little 'me.' When we act from the ego, suffering is the eventual consequence.

Pain Body: a heavy, dense field of energy that is attracted to the suffering and emotional outbursts in others.

Presence: that awake and aware state which brings conscious attention into the Now aka the present moment.

Presence can dissolve the ego and transform the pain body. I equate this awakening from the egoic state with the wizard in the Wizard of Oz. Once you draw back the curtain, you can see the trickster for the illusion that it is!

Conscious Relationship: a connection between two awake beings that is free from the needs and attachments of the ego; a relationship based solely on love, mutuality and respect.

Surrender: that state of complete acceptance to what is, so that peace might arise.
